Deutsche Telekom(DT), Wednesday launched Deutsche Telekom Strategic Investments (DTSI), a new unit designed to streamline and accelerate investment in technology, media and telecommunications (TMT) innovation. DTSI will manage the existing T-Venture portfolio, DT’s strategic venture capital group, including follow-on investment.
T-Venture is founded in 1997, with a cumulative budget volume of over 750 million Euro and is one of the largest corporate venture funds in the technology industry. The firm has made over 200 investments and currently manages a portfolio of around 90 companies, including several ‘unicorns’, said DT in a statement.
T-Venture is the foundation of DTSI, which will also include Telekom Innovation Pool (TIP), another Deutsche Telekom strategic investment fund. The combined unit will have over 360 million Euro in capital under management.
